Still a baby but already extraordinary. The wine is straightforward and true to its terroir, to the nose it is elegant and complex, it makes you drift away with your thoughts. Secondary and tertiary aromas are coming forward after any sip. In the mouth it surprises you with its strength, and shows powerful tannins, freshness and acidity. It certainly has many more years ahead. Olek has a natural approach to farming, the impressive work he himself does in the vineyard is put in value with his respectful winemaking style. He proposes a really classy interpretation for his rich nebbiolo fruit. For this bottle, we decanted short before drinking. — 6 years ago

This is the drift rows single vineyard cab (oakville 88 vineyard). Virtual tasting with Justin and Andrew. They made this different than the typical hunnicutt big and rich style. They picked a little earlier for a more ageworthy balanced wine. Nice minerality and dark cherry. 93-94+. Would like to see this in 10 years but you can drink it now with a decant. — 5 years ago

The aromas from this wine drift across the room. Leather, tobacco, coffee, smooth red fruit. On the palate, great complexity with the same tone as the nose, with tobacco sticking around longer on the finish. Great wine. — 7 years ago
